

Only about two hours away south of Manila, Tagaytay sits on a ridge 685 meters above Taal Lake and its active volcano-island. From a vantage point along the ridge, one can get a good look at the maws of a seemingly placid but volatile Taal Volcano surrounded by the gleaming waters of the lake. The cool, breezy, and at times foggy weather makes it an ideal summer getaway next to Baguio City. The extensive fruit and flower gardens lining the main road are attributed to its rich, fertile soil.
